一般认为哮喘与支气管收缩剂的过度反应密切相关。但偶尔也见某些哮喘者无这种过度反应性。业已表明过度反应性的缺如可能是假象,与FEV_1测量法有关。因FEV_1测量需要一次最大吸气,而后者扩张某些哮喘者收缩的气道,并可防止吸入支气管收缩剂后的FEV_1明显下降。本文不用预先最大吸气的方法而用比气道传导检测法(SRaw)观察3例哮喘者对碳酰胆碱的反应,结果出现哮喘症状而无气道过度反应。确诊为哮喘患者3例在停用β肾上腺素能支气管扩张药及皮质激素类药后吸入碳酰胆碱3 m g,6~18个月后重复此激发试验。于每次吸入前后分别测量SRaw。本文认为吸入碳酰胆碱3 mg 后,SRaw 增加低于50%者为非哮喘反应。
It is generally believed that asthma and bronchoconstrictor overreaction is closely related. But occasionally see some asthma without this overreactivity. It has been shown that the absence of overreactivity may be an illusion associated with the FEV_1 measure. The FEV_1 measurement requires a maximum inspiratory effort, while the latter dilates the contracted airways in some asthmatic subjects and prevents a significant decrease in FEV_1 after inhaled bronchoconstrictor. This article does not use the method of pre-maximum aspiration with the airway conduction test (SRaw) observed in 3 asthmatic patients on the reaction of carbachol, asthma symptoms without airway hyperresponsiveness. Three patients diagnosed with asthma inhaled carbachol 3 m g after discontinuation of β-adrenergic bronchodilators and corticosteroids, and the challenge test was repeated 6 to 18 months later. SRaw was measured before and after each inhalation. This article suggests that inhalation of carbachol 3 mg, SRaw increased less than 50% were non-asthmatic reactions.
